Joel Beckerman, award-winning composer and founder of Man Made Music, delves into the transformative power of sonic branding in Sonic Boom, blending insights from media, business, and psychology.

A pioneer in strategic sound design, Beckerman has crafted iconic themes for ESPN’s 30 for 30, NBC Nightly News, and Super Bowl XLVI, while shaping sonic identities for brands like AT&T and Disney.

His work with collaborators ranging from John Williams to John Legend underscores his cross-industry influence, amplified by recognition in Fast Company’s “Most Creative People in Business” list.

Sonic Boom synthesizes decades of experience into a guide on harnessing sound’s emotional impact, reflecting Beckerman’s ASCAP-winning career and his firm’s global client portfolio. The book draws from real-world case studies used by Fortune 500 companies and major networks, cementing its relevance for marketers and creatives alike.

Boom moments are instances where sound triggers strong emotions or memories. Examples include Chili’s sizzling fajita sound (stimulating hunger) or Disney’s park soundscapes (enhancing immersion). Beckerman argues these moments are key to building brand loyalty and emotional engagement.

Sonic branding involves creating a distinct audio identity, like Intel’s chime or Southwest Airlines’ boarding music. Beckerman emphasizes simplicity and consistency, showing how sounds aligned with brand values (e.g., NBC’s high-energy Super Bowl theme) deepen customer connections.

Some may find its focus skewed toward corporate success over artistic or ethical considerations. While it critiques "sonic trash," it prioritizes commercial applications, offering less exploration of sound’s societal or cultural impacts.
